41 Belgrave Crescent, Sunbury-On-Thames, TW16 5NE is a freehold semi-detached property built between 1967-1975. The property offers approximately 893 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have three b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£532,072 , which equates to approximately £596 per square foot. It was last sold on 19 Aug 2022 for £506,000. Since then, the value has increased by £26,072, representing a 5.2% increase, or approximately 1.6% per year.

The current estimated value of £532,072 is:

  • 23.0% higher than the average property price on Belgrave Crescent
  • 14.2% higher than the average in the TW16 5NE postcode area
  • and 9.6% lower than the average price for Sunbury-On-Thames as a whole

41 Belgrave Crescent, Sunbury-On-Thames, Spelthorne, Surrey, TW16 5NE has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 29 Jan 2025.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 12 Jul 2012, when the property was rated D. Since then, the rating has improved to C,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 18%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 200 mm loft insulation to pitched, 270 mm loft insulation, with no change in energy efficiency (good).
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ed) to cavity wall, filled cavity, improving energy efficiency from poor to average.
  • The lighting was changed from low energy lighting in 88%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in all fixed outlets, with no change in efficiency (very good).
